The Straight Tee Dress
The straight tee dress is your favorite boxy t-shirt with some extra length. It’s loose and comfortable and suits most body types.
When buying online, check the length, as some of these dresses can be quite short. You don’t want to look like you just forgot to wear pants!? If there are no measurements, ask their customer service department. Sometimes you can tell how a dress will fit you by looking at the model, but it makes much more sense to know your own measurements and check them against the fit details of the dress.
If you like the look of an oversized t-shirt, then try Madewell’s Tomboy Pocket Tee Dress in 100% organic cotton. This dress is 35 1/2″ from the high point shoulder, which is where the neck opening meets the shoulder. To make sure this works for you, take a tape measure, hold it at the side of the neck opening, and drop it straight down. Face a mirror, so that you can see where 35 1/2″ lands on your body.

The Fitted Tee Dress
A fitted dress follows the curves of your body but doesn’t necessarily hug you as a body-con dress would. I think this style fits best on a straight, athletic, or slightly curvy body types.
I’m wearing the adidas Culture Pack Dress in a size small. It’s fitted without being too clingy, and the seams on the side give it a figure-flattering shape. It’s a little short for me to wear around town, but I would wear it by the pool with some Comfort Flip Flops. For reference, I am just under 5’4″, around 123 lbs and pear or triangle shaped.

The Flirty Tee Dress
The flirty tee dress is fitted on top with an a-line or full skirt. I think this style suits most body types and is easy to dress up or down.
For a mini short-sleeved style, take a look at Everlane “Party of One” Tee Dress. This would look cute with ballet flats or block heels for a casual night out.
I also like Pact’s organic cotton, strappy Fit And Flare Midi Dress, and Everlane’s Luxe Cotton Seamed Dress. Both are midi length.
There are also some cute maxi dresses online, but I find that maxi tees can be heavy and look a little frumpy if you’re not tall and model-thin. (If you find one you love, let me know in the comments below!)
